CanadaWhere can I find the Montreal Hotel guide???
No electronics of any kind!! When I was there, 1 guy wasn't allowed in becuase he had a remote on his key chain! as well no big bags/purses. One of those plastic accordian binders with compartments works great (mine had 13,lol) as you can separate everything!1 keep ur interview letter handy, as the security guards wil want to see it. You go through airport like security, so you don't want a lot of metal/coins on ya! and yes if ur bag is too big, they won't allow u in!

CanadaQUESTIONS ASKED IN INTERVIEW
Interview is very very basic!! They ask questions like:

How you met. What does your fiance do? Do you plan to work in the USA?, if so what? Very, very basic for the most part.

CanadaWanting to visit fiance in Florida while K1 is pending? What do I need?
1) Always tell the TRUTH. never lie to the POE officer
2) Be confident in ur replies
3)keep ur response short and to the point, dont tell ur life story!!
4) look the POE officer in the eye when speaking to them. They are looking for people lieing and have been trained to find them!
5)pack light! No job resumes with you
6) Bring ties to Canada (letter from employer when ur expected back at work, lease, etc etc)
7) Always be polite, being rude isnt going to get ya anywhere, and could make things worse!!
8) have a plan in case u do get denied (be polite) It wont harm ur visa application if ur denied,that is if ur polite and didnt lie! Refer to #1
